InFA
Input Phase Loss Circuit Error
Schneider Electric · Altivar Machine ATV320 Variable Speed Drive
What does InFA mean?
A detected error in the input phase loss circuit. This indicates a problem with the drive's internal sensing of the incoming mains voltage phases, which is crucial for detecting power supply issues. This fault may falsely indicate a phase loss or miss a real one, impacting drive protection.
Common Causes
- Loss of one or more input phases detected by the drive's monitoring circuit.
- Loose connection on the main power input terminals (L1, L2, L3).
- Failure of a phase monitoring component within the drive.
- Motor winding fault causing uneven phase currents.
Repair Steps & Checklist

- 1
Verify that all incoming three-phase power connections to the drive are secure and correct.
- 2
Check incoming mains voltage for stability and balance across all phases.
- 3
Power cycle the drive to reset the internal sensing logic.
- 4
If the fault persists, it indicates an internal hardware issue with the input phase detection circuit, requiring repair or replacement.
